1. Technical Roadmap & Ecosystem Growth (Bullish Impact)

Overview: The project's near-term development is focused on enhancing interoperability and accessibility. A public Technical Steering Committee meeting was scheduled for May 22, 2026, to discuss the Polymesh 8.0 update and demonstrate a proof-of-concept for an EVM bridge (TradingView). Previous upgrades, like v7.3 in July 2025, relaxed identity requirements to improve user onboarding (Polymesh). What this means: Successful implementation of the EVM bridge could attract developers and assets from the larger Ethereum ecosystem, increasing network activity and transaction fee demand for POLYX. These technical milestones are concrete catalysts that could positively impact sentiment and price in the coming months.

2. Real-World Asset (RWA) Sector Momentum (Bullish Impact)

Overview: POLYX is fundamentally tied to the growth of tokenizing traditional assets like stocks and bonds. This market surpassed $20 billion in 2026 and is seen as a multi-trillion dollar opportunity (TokenPost). Analysts list POLYX among the top infrastructure tokens for this sector (Phemex). What this means: As a blockchain built specifically for regulated assets, Polymesh stands to capture a significant share of this growth. Increased tokenization volume would require more POLYX for gas fees, staking, and governance, creating sustained, organic demand pressure on the token's price over the long term.

3. Regulatory Environment & Institutional Adoption (Mixed Impact)

Overview: Polymesh's value proposition is its compliance-ready architecture. Regulatory progress, such as the SEC reviewing tokenized stock trading on Nasdaq, validates the sector (CoinMarketCap). Conversely, delays or restrictive policies could slow adoption. What this means: Clear, supportive regulation is a major bullish catalyst, as it lowers the barrier for traditional finance entities to use Polymesh. However, the token's price remains vulnerable to broader crypto regulatory crackdowns and the pace of institutional onboarding, which can be slower than retail-driven hype cycles.
